Paleoenvironmental Reconstruction of the Upper Paleolithic Site Near Kamyanka Village Paleoenvironmental reconstruction is an important part of the multidisciplinary study of the Upper Paleolithical sites. Pollen analysis is one of the prospective approaches for this purpose. From the excavation wall of the site near Kamyanka village, which technological complex belongs to the eastern Epi-Gravettian, 8 samples were taken and palynologically studied (two of them from the cultural layer). The obtained pollen spectra show that at the time of the site functioning, this area was located in the subperiglacial steppe. The climate was much colder and drier than that of today. The vegetation cover was sparser, poorer and more uniform in composition. As the site was situated in the river valley, it was surrounded by light woods and meadows from grasses and mesophytic herbs.
